Transaction 75083f29070d6f84141660608495aba8b65aa01c9229387249de927414a4b883

5 Input
2 Outputs
  • 75083f29070d6f84141660608495aba8b65aa01c9229387249de927414a4b883:0
  • value  49030000
    address  16rWjash2eHC8Ckh7VGLg2f8V2e9YN2HVW
  • 75083f29070d6f84141660608495aba8b65aa01c9229387249de927414a4b883:1
  • value  944719
    address  1K85GEvRu2L6GdZvGk1PdMhCBw4GLmHaLo